Abstract

The invention discloses a kind of variable information board message routing methods based on vehicle location estimation, comprising the following steps: (1) obtains the traffic offence information of vehicle;(2) with the constructing traffic offence local highway network model of region, estimates the driving path of vehicle, every driving path has at least one variable information board;(3) probability that vehicle reaches first variable information board on every driving path is calculated;(4) estimation vehicle reaches the time T of the variable information board M of maximum probability1, and in T1Moment is by the illegal information of variable information board issuing traffic.The factors such as driving parameters when this method comprehensively considers vehicle illegal place, vehicle illegal and the time difference between current time and vehicle illegal time, so that the illegal information informed has directionality, real-time, visuality.

Background technique
Currently, most of information content that expressway variable message plate is shown is indicative content, such as bad weather, danger Dangerous section etc., mainly on highway it is all pass through vehicle, have generality, easily cause the vision of driver in this way Fatigue.
Vehicle location estimation has the following problems: (1) obtaining vehicle location using positioning devices such as GPS, be completely dependent on vehicle Positioning device on positions vehicle;Since the signal of the positioning devices such as GPS is local very in tunnel, underground parking etc. It is faint, it might even be possible to ignore, vehicle is caused not have GPS signal or the faint place of GPS signal cannot be to vehicle at these It is positioned.(2) method combined using the parameter of the positioning devices such as GPS and the traveling of acquisition vehicle itself, i.e. inertia are led Boat positions vehicle.Vehicle is determined using positioning devices such as GPS in the preferable place of the positioning devices such as GPS signal Position;Vehicle is positioned using inertial navigation in the faint place of no GPS signal or GPS signal.(3) if vehicle did not both have There are the positioning devices such as installation GPS or the location information of vehicle cannot be obtained, also there is no vehicle driving parameter, then such case Under vehicle cannot be positioned.
Variable information board shows that information has the following problems on highway: (1) show that information is mostly prompt category information, and It is not have directionality for the vehicle Jing Guo variable information board for all vehicles on highway.(2) even if The display information of variable information board has directionality, but most of display information is that manual hand manipulation shows, real-time It is poor.
Current freeway traffic illegal activities evidence obtaining is difficult, Difficult Law-enforcement, especially law enforcement real-time are poor, effect of enforcing the law is paid no attention to Think, it is difficult to meet road traffic security control demand.Therefore, the information that urgent need variable information board is shown has orientation Property, real-time, visuality, such as display pass through vehicle traffic offence information, can break through in this way traffic behavior assess in real time, The problems such as typical traffic illegal activities height is precisely collected evidence.

The technical solution of the present invention is as follows:
A kind of variable information board message routing method based on vehicle location estimation, comprising the following steps:
(1) the traffic offence information of vehicle is obtained;
(2) construct traffic offence region local highway network model, estimate the driving path of vehicle, every row Path is sailed at least one variable information board;
(3) probability that vehicle reaches first variable information board on every driving path is calculated;
(4) estimation vehicle reaches the time T of the variable information board of maximum probability1, and in T1Moment is sent out by the variable information board Cloth traffic offence information.
In the present invention, disobeyed using the traffic offence place of the positioning devices such as GPS acquisition vehicle, traffic offence time, traffic Driving direction when speed when method, traffic offence forms traffic offence information.
In step (2), vehicle current driving location is first estimated, the traveling road of vehicle is then estimated according to current driving location Diameter.The average value of the Maximum speed limit of express highway section and minimum speed limit where calculating vehicle illegal place, and select this average The maximum value of both speeds when value and vehicle illegal calculates current time T and vehicle illegal time T as vehicle velocity V0Difference Δ T, and distance of the vehicle from the illegal moment to current driving is obtained according to formula S=V * Δ T, and estimate according to this distance current The driving path of vehicle.
The specific steps of step (3) are as follows:
(3-1) is according to section crowding, node exit record and link traffic flow, license plate number and vehicle in front of node Historical record calculates i-th node N of the vehicle in local highway network modeliThe probability P in j-th of direction is driven towards at placei,j, In, i=1,2,3 ..., I;J=1,2, I be the total number of local highway network model interior joint;
(3-2) is according to probability Pi,j,, calculate illegal vehicle and encounter first variable information board on kth driving path Probability Pk, wherein k=1,2,3 ..., K, K are the total number of driving path.
In the present invention, node refers to the outlet port on highway, which is to change highway node, Mei Gejie Can be there are two vehicle heading at point, one is to continue forward direction along current highway, the other is with current The highway direction of highway interaction, it is believed that be driving direction to the right.
At each node, influence vehicle heading factor are as follows: section crowding in front of node, node exit record with Link traffic flow, license plate number and vehicle historical record.
If: it is P that section crowding, which influences the probability of forward travel, in front of nodei,f1, it is to the probability of right travel Pi,r1If front section crowding is higher, Pi,f1Less than Pi,r1, conversely, Pi,f1Greater than Pi,r1, specific value can be according to front road Section crowding grade sets itself.For example, probability assignments can be allocated according to table 1.
Table 1
The probability that the available vehicular seat of license plate number influences forward travel is Pi,f2, to the probability of right travel For Pi,r2;If license plate number location is on right lateral direction, Pi,f2Less than Pi,r2;If license plate number location is in preceding line direction On, Pi,f2Greater than Pi,r2;If license plate number location is not neither on preceding line direction and on right lateral direction, this group of probability can It ignores.For example, probability assignments can be allocated according to table 2.
Table 2
Historical record it is available with vehicle in front forward and the ratio to right travel, and then obtain influencing forward travel Probability be Pi,f3, it is P to the probability of right traveli,r3;According to historical record, vehicle passes through node NiForward direction travel times nf3With Dextrad travel times nr3, be calculated before to the probability of traveling be Pi,f3=nf3/(nf3+nr3) and probability to right travel be Pi,r3=nr3/(nf3+nr3).If nf3=nr3=0, then this group of probability is negligible.
Node exit record is with had vehicle at available this node up to now of link traffic flow forward and to another The ratio of a traveling, and then the probability for obtaining influencing forward travel is Pi,f4, it is P to the probability of right traveli,r4;When unit Between interior nodes NiOutlet record frequency nr4With link traffic flow n4, be calculated before to traveling probability be Pi,f4=1-nr4/n4The right side and It is P to traveling probabilityi,r4=nr4/n4
It is calculated according to above four influence vehicle heading factors in i-th of node NiPlace, forward travel probability Pi,1, vehicle is to right travel probability Pi,2, specifically:
Pi,1=Pi,f1×Pi,f2×Pi,f3×Pi,f4
Pi,2=Pi,r1+Pi,f1×Pi,r2+Pi,f1×Pi,f2×Pi,r3+Pi,f1×Pi,f2×Pi,f3×Pi,r4
In aforementioned four influence vehicle heading factor, if without or cannot obtain s-th of factor data, it is corresponding general Rate is Pi,fs=1, Pi,rs=0, s=1,2,3,4.
Such as: in node NiPlace, cannot obtain node NiThis influence vehicle heading factor of front section crowding, Then Pi,f1=1, Pi,r1=0, at this point, forward travel probability Pi,1, vehicle is to right travel probability Pi,2Specifically:
Pi,1=Pi,f2×Pi,f3×Pi,f4
Pi,2=Pi,r2+Pi,f2×Pi,r3+Pi,f2×Pi,f3×Pi,r4
Obtaining probability Pi,jAfter possible driving path, acquisition vehicle reaches first on kth driving path and can be changed The probability P of advices platekSpecific steps are as follows:
Firstly, obtaining vehicle, from traffic offence place to reach vehicle on this driving path through kth driving path current The m node that first variable information board is passed through in front of possible position driving direction forms node set Ck={ N1,N2,…, Nm};
Then, node set C is transferredkIn vehicle moves forward along place driving path at each node Probability pi,j; Here, it is assumed that in node N1Place, vehicle are turned right into next highway, then by this node N1The vehicle at place is to right travel Probability P1,2The Probability p to move forward as vehicle along place driving pathi,j
Finally, according to formulaVehicle is calculated and reaches vehicle currently possibility on kth driving path The probability P of first variable information board in front of the driving direction of positionk
Obtaining probability PkAfterwards, maximum probability P is chosenkCorresponding variable information board M issues vehicular traffic violation information 's.After determining variable information board M and driving path, calculate vehicle along the driving path reach variable information board M when Between T1, specifically:
Firstly, determining two according to the position of position, variable information board M on the driving path where current time T vehicle The distance between position Δ S;
Then, the average value of the Maximum speed limit of express highway section and minimum speed limit where calculating variable information board M, and select The maximum value of both the average value and speed when vehicle illegal is selected as vehicle velocity V;
Finally, according to formula T1Time T is calculated in=T+ Δ S/V1
It is worth noting that the time T of heretofore described arrival variable information board M1Referring to that driver can see clearly can Become in advices plate M and shows the time of content.
Further, the method for the present invention further includes estimating that vehicle sails out of the time T of variable information board M2, and in T2When remove The traffic offence information of vehicle.
The vehicle sails out of the time T of variable information board M2=T1+Te, wherein TeGenerally fixed value, value 20 ~30s.
Further, the method for the present invention further includes the record that real-time update vehicle crosses each node, is gone through as the vehicle The Records of the Historian is employed in estimation probability P of the vehicle at node next timei,j
